Story summary
- Renee Hardman (D) won a special election for Iowa Senate District 16, becoming the first Black woman elected to the Iowa Senate.
- Hardman defeated Republican Lucas Loftin by over 40 percentage points, preventing Republicans from regaining a supermajority.
- The race followed the death of Democratic Sen. Claire Celsi in October.
- The victory creates a dynamic where Republicans must seek Democratic support for gubernatorial appointments.
